In each of these, the x- and y-components of a vector aregiven. Find the magnitude and direction of the vector. (d) ax = 2.3 m/s2 , ay = 6.5 m/s2. I did mag F = (2.3m/s2)2 + (6.5 m/s2)2 =47.54 = 6.89 m/s2 = Fmag. tan = opp/adj = tan -1 (opp/adj) = tan -1 (6.5 m/s2 / 2.3 m/s2) = 70.5 deg CCW from the + x-axis Book says ...... F mag = 2.3 m/s2 at 1.6 deg CCWfrom +x-axis. Is book right? If so, how to solve correctly? thanks, Paul In each of these, the x- and y-components of a vector aregiven.
